Released on January 18, 2005, The Game’s debut album, did more than just introduce a new rapper—it revitalized West Coast hip-hop. Under the guidance of Dr. Dre and 50 Cent, Game delivered a project that blended gritty storytelling with mainstream appeal, cementing its status as a classic.

During the blog-era of hip-hop (the mid-2000s to early 2010s), zip files hosted on platforms like MediaFire, MegaUpload, and RapidShare were the primary method for fans to share and download music. While streaming has largely taken over, the habit of searching for "zip" files persists among collectors, archivists, and those looking for offline media storage. By 2004, the epicenter of hip-hop had shifted heavily toward the South and the East Coast. Aside from the lingering dominance of Snoop Dogg and Dr. Dre’s behind-the-scenes engineering, the West Coast lacked a young, aggressive voice to compete with the likes of 50 Cent and Eminem.
